Sony VPL-VW10HT Specification

The Sony VPL-VW10HT is a high-performance home theater projector that delivers an immersive cinematic experience. It features a native resolution of 1366 x 768 pixels, using Sony's advanced SXRD (Silicon X-tal Reflective Display) technology to provide exceptional image clarity and color accuracy. The projector boasts a brightness level of 1000 ANSI lumens, ensuring vibrant and clear images even in moderately lit environments. Its contrast ratio of 500:1 enhances the depth and detail of the visuals, making it suitable for a wide range of viewing content, from movies to sports.

This model is equipped with a 250W UHP lamp, offering a lamp life of approximately 2000 hours, which helps reduce maintenance costs and downtime. The VPL-VW10HT supports a range of input options, including component video, S-Video, and composite video, allowing for flexibility in connecting different media sources. Its lens offers a manual zoom and focus adjustment, providing a throw ratio of 1.5 to 1.8, which accommodates various room sizes and projector placements.

The projector supports a wide range of video formats, including 480i, 480p, 720p, and 1080i, ensuring compatibility with modern and legacy content. It includes features like digital keystone correction and image shift to enhance image alignment and installation flexibility. The compact design and quiet operation, with a noise level of approximately 32 dB, make it an ideal choice for home theater setups where space and noise levels are a concern. Overall, the Sony VPL-VW10HT combines advanced technology with user-friendly features, making it a reliable choice for home entertainment enthusiasts seeking high-quality projection capabilities.

Sony VPL-VW10HT F.A.Q.

How do I reset the lamp timer on the Sony VPL-VW10HT?

To reset the lamp timer, press "Menu" on the remote control, navigate to "Setup," select "Lamp Timer Reset," and confirm the reset by selecting "Yes."

What is the recommended maintenance schedule for the Sony VPL-VW10HT projector?

It is recommended to clean the air filter every 300 hours of use and replace the lamp after approximately 2000 hours. Regularly check for dust accumulation and ensure proper ventilation.

What should I do if the projector is overheating?

Make sure the air vents are not blocked, clean the air filter, ensure ambient room temperature is cool, and avoid placing the projector in an enclosed space.

Why is there no image displayed when the projector is turned on?

Check if the lens cap is removed, ensure the input source is correctly selected, verify the cables are properly connected, and confirm the lamp is functioning.

What should I do if the image projected is distorted?

Adjust the keystone correction settings, ensure the projector is level, and check that the distance between the projector and screen is within the recommended range.

How do I replace the lamp in the Sony VPL-VW10HT?

Turn off the projector and unplug it. Allow the lamp to cool, open the lamp cover, unscrew the old lamp, and replace it with a new one. Secure the lamp cover before powering on the projector.

Can I mount the Sony VPL-VW10HT on the ceiling?

Yes, the projector can be ceiling-mounted. Ensure to use a compatible ceiling mount kit and follow the installation instructions for safe and secure mounting.
